powershell proxy check

Pagina: 1
Acties:

Acties:
  • 0 Henk 'm!

  • dexter18
  • Registratie: December 2004
  • Laatst online: 04-10 19:59
Hallo,

Laat ik maar eerst toegeven dat ik een complete noob ben op het gebied van scripting. wij zijn op het bedrijf waar ik werk aan het testen met een nieuwe proxy. Hiervoor gebruiken een aantal test users een andere pac file dan gewone gebruikers. Helaas hebben wij hier een group policy die deze instelling checkt en indien verkeerd terug zet naar de normale pac file. Om onze testgebruikers te helpen wilde ik een powershell scriptje maken die kijkt welke pac file je gebruikt en indien dit de normale is hij de nieuwe insteld. Na wat googlen heb ik het volgende scriptje geknutseld:
$val = Get-ItemProperty -path "hkcu:Software\Microsoft\Windows\CurrentVersion\Internet Settings" -Name "AutoConfigURL"
if($val.AutoConfigURL -ne "Juiste pacfile link")
{
set-itemproperty -path "hkcu:Software\Microsoft\Windows\CurrentVersion\Internet Settings" -name AutoConfigURL -value "Juiste pacfile link" -type string
}
Nu heb ik hier 2 vragen over.

1. Ik loop nu tegen het probleem aan dat als ik dit script opsla als een ps1 file en dan run in powershell klik doet hij het niet. Maar als ik powershell opstart en dan het erin kopieer en plak dan doet hij het wel. Wat doe ik fout?

2. Hoe script ik er een soort loop in dat hij bijvoorbeeld om de 2 minuten het script uitvoert?

Alvast bedankt.

Acties:
  • 0 Henk 'm!

  • NMe
  • Registratie: Februari 2004
  • Laatst online: 09-09 13:58

NMe

Quia Ego Sic Dico.

'E's fighting in there!' he stuttered, grabbing the captain's arm.
'All by himself?' said the captain.
'No, with everyone!' shouted Nobby, hopping from one foot to the other.


Acties:
  • 0 Henk 'm!

  • Caeruleus
  • Registratie: November 2001
  • Laatst online: 07-10 15:52
Of je maakt een groep, plaatst alle test users in die groep zorg je ervoor dat de group policy niet van toepassing is op deze groep.

no animals were harmed during the production of this message


Acties:
  • 0 Henk 'm!

  • dexter18
  • Registratie: December 2004
  • Laatst online: 04-10 19:59
Caeruleus schreef op woensdag 04 februari 2015 @ 10:36:
Of je maakt een groep, plaatst alle test users in die groep zorg je ervoor dat de group policy niet van toepassing is op deze groep.
Ik wens je succes om daarmee hier door het management heen te komen ;) we proberen dat namelijk al ongeveer 5 maanden.

Acties:
  • 0 Henk 'm!

  • Mystery
  • Registratie: Mei 2000
  • Laatst online: 26-09 09:10
Als je Powershell als admin start en daarin doet je script het wel dan is er misschien een andere ExecutionPolicy actief als gebruiker. Misschien kan je powershell.exe -ExecutionPolicy Unrestricted -File pad_en_naam.ps1 kunnen uitvoeren.

Battle.net tag


Acties:
  • 0 Henk 'm!

  • LostinFFM
  • Registratie: Juli 2010
  • Laatst online: 11-09 08:56
Set-ExecutionPolicy RemoteSigned

Execution Policy Change
The execution policy helps protect you from scripts that you do not trust. Changing the execution policy might expose you to the security risks described in
the about_Execution_Policies help topic at http://go.microsoft.com/fwlink/?LinkID=135170. Do you want to change the execution policy?
[Y] Yes [N] No [S] Suspend [?] Help (default is "Y"):

Om het script om de zo veel tijd uit te voeren, gewoon als scheduled task inrichten.

Acties:
  • 0 Henk 'm!

  • garriej
  • Registratie: December 2012
  • Laatst online: 01-10 11:55

garriej

Ik las ondertieten.

dexter18 schreef op woensdag 04 februari 2015 @ 10:37:
[...]

Ik wens je succes om daarmee hier door het management heen te komen ;) we proberen dat namelijk al ongeveer 5 maanden.
je moet naar je manager om een test user / ou aan te maken? en hij zegt nee?
Pagina: 1